MySQL是一个流行的关系型数据库管理系统,通过MySQL客户端可以连接到MySQL服务器进行管理和操作。本文将介绍MySQL的基本管理操作和连接方式。
1. MySQL管理操作
1.1 登录MySQL
使用以下命令登录到MySQL服务器,需要提供用户名和密码:
```bash mysql -u username -p ```
1.2 创建数据库
使用`CREATE DATABASE`语句创建新的数据库:
```sql CREATE DATABASE dbname; ```
1.3 删除数据库
使用`DROP DATABASE`语句删除数据库:
```sql DROP DATABASE dbname; ```
1.4 创建表
使用`CREATE TABLE`语句创建新的表:
```sql CREATE TABLE tablename ( column1 datatype, column2 datatype, ... ); ```
1.5 删除表
使用`DROP TABLE`语句删除表:
```sql DROP TABLE tablename; ```
1.6 插入数据
使用`INSERT INTO`语句向表中插入数据:
```sql INSERT INTO tablename (column1, column2, ...) VALUES (value1, value2, ...); ```
1.7 查询数据
使用`SELECT`语句查询数据:
```sql SELECT * FROM tablename; ```
1.8 更新数据
使用`UPDATE`语句更新数据:
```sql DELETE FROM tablename WHERE condition; ```
1.9 删除数据
使用`DELETE FROM`语句删除数据:
```sql DELETE FROM tablename WHERE condition; ```
2. MySQL连接方式
2.1 命令行连接
通过命令行工具连接到MySQL服务器,可以执行SQL语句和管理数据库:
```bash mysql -u username -p -h hostname ```
2.2 图形化界面连接
使用图形化工具如MySQL Workbench、Navicat等连接到MySQL服务器,可以方便地管理数据库和执行SQL语句。
2.3 编程语言连接
使用编程语言(如Python、Java等)的MySQL驱动程序连接到MySQL服务器,可以通过编程实现对数据库的管理和操作。
2.4 Web应用连接
通过Web应用程序连接到MySQL服务器,可以实现在线数据管理和操作。
3. MySQL连接参数
3.1 用户名和密码
连接MySQL服务器时,需要提供用户名和密码:
```bash mysql -u username -p ```
3.2 主机名
如果MySQL服务器不在本地,需要指定主机名或IP地址:
```bash mysql -u username -p -h hostname ```
3.3 端口号
默认情况下,MySQL服务器使用3306端口,如果端口不同,需要指定端口号:
```bash mysql -u username -p -h hostname -P port ```
3.4 数据库名
连接到特定数据库,可以在连接命令中指定数据库名:
```bash mysql -u username -p -h hostname dbname ```
4. 总结
本文介绍了MySQL的基本管理操作和连接方式。通过掌握这些知识,可以更好地管理和操作MySQL数据库,实现数据的存储和查询。MySQL提供了多种连接方式,可以根据需求选择合适的方式进行连接和操作。